DOWNTOWN LA ARTWALK
by ShowzArt and SkidRobot
Self-proclaimed “art jedi” ShowzArt credits his mother with his passion for community and his father with his illustrative abilities. Moving to South Central Los Angeles with his family as a child ShowzArt was introduced to graffiti early on but soon traded spray cans for brushes. Actively working from the streets of Skid Row, Showzart has been a powerful voice for equal rights and services for all disenfranchised, no matter their background. Also raised in Los Angeles SkidRobot—founder of the Living Art Project—has been perhaps the most visible artistic voice addressing the city’s complex homelessness issues with his paintings of dream homes and beachscapes on the walls of Skid Row helping bridge the gulf between the “us” and the “them.” In early 2018 the two joined forces to paint this wall on S. Spring St for the Downtown LA ArtWalk. @_showzart_/ @skidrobot/
